**Contractor First-Day Checklist — Cleaning-Crew Access**

Before starting at Ostery Mill, confirm with the Varden Facilities desk which zones your cleaning rota covers, as access differs by wing. Collect your kit from the store on Level 1, sign the equipment log, and check that out-of-hours alarms for your zones are disarmed on the panel schedule. To open the service corridor door to the west wing, enter the code below.

badge for hahif-faweg: bdg-VF-9

Password reset revamp — plugin notes. The legacy Keystring reset flow is deprecated; the new Vaultpath flow ships in v4. Plugins must stop calling the old reset endpoint by the cutover date. Token format changes: shorter lifetime, single use, bound to session origin. Hooks available: `preResetChallenge` and `postResetConfirm`. Sandbox credentials are issued per plugin; request them through the developer portal. Migration guide is in the Vaultpath docs. Questions about hook behavior go to the auth platform team.

alerts address for bajop-yahog: istwyn@lumiclabs.internal

## Changelog — Ticktrace 1.9

### Renamed: DRIFT_API_TOKEN
During the cron drift investigation we found plugins confusing this variable with the metrics token, so it has been renamed to indicate it authorizes drift-report uploads specifically. Plugin authors must read the new name from 1.9 onward; the old name is ignored without warning. Sample env files in the SDK are updated. In your deployment env file, the drift-report upload secret is set on the next line.

env line for fawef-taguf: VAULT_KEY13=a9695905a9a90

Subject: Ownership change — loyalty-points ledger

Team,

Effective next sprint, ownership of the PerkLedger service moves out of the Checkout pod. Reconciliation jobs, the accrual API, and the nightly balance snapshots all transfer with it. Open tickets will be re-triaged this week; don't start new ledger work until the board settles. Escalations during the transition still go through the on-call rotation as usual.

For the weekly sync: direct all ledger questions and approvals to the new owner named below.

named custodian: Brivan Eliath Quenox Frador